I searched but found no definitive answer... Is anyone else having this issue?
I am running Mythbuntu Lucid (10.04 LTS) and Sabnzbdplus .06. I am not having a problem with playing videos. Videos play fine in Mythbuntu but anytime I have to do anything involving my wireless keyboard/mouse combo while a download is going on, the mouse barely works. Same thing with the keyboard.
The keyboard/mouse combo is the btc 9019urf. Works great when Im not downloading something.
Load average is at 64% on this machine. It has a quadcore cpu and 8gig of ram so I really don't think those are the problem. My swap is not being used because I have more than enough ram.
I read a bit about ionice and was wondering if there is a way to give the keyboard/mouse higher priority?
